Output f93d3fc601080ee48a428314a38afe7e54f8c1e6ae627e43bfde20b059ba69e1:0

value
757116317
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8b21e44bde8ac9c901de5f41f7368c23a4913ca OP_EQUALVERIFY OP_CHECKSIG
address
1HqaiAnwC2bF4r9X9uQ4xE3D9z6mW1K1kA
transaction
f93d3fc601080ee48a428314a38afe7e54f8c1e6ae627e43bfde20b059ba69e1
confirmations
504032
spent
true